‘Let Me Finish!’ De Blasio Scolds Hannity in Heated Exchange
Former New York City Mayor Bill de Blasio repeatedly clashed with Fox News host Sean Hannity on Wednesday, at one point snapping, “Let me finish!” as the two sparred over Democratic socialist candidates.
Commenting on the right’s condemnation of the Democratic Party’s socialist swing, de Blasio said that President Donald Trump’s MAGA movement “to a lot of mainstream Republicans, was considered absolutely radical… and yet, it tapped into something that a lot of Americans were concerned about.”
“I don’t know why there’s a double standard here,” he added of Democratic socialists.
Hannity went on to bring up a candidate supported by New York City Mayor Zohran Mamdani — Darializa Avila Chevalier, who just won the Democratic primary for New York’s 13th Congressional District.
Their exchange continued:
HANNITY: She wants to abolish the police completely. Let’s go through it all. She wants to abolish America’s prisons completely. She wants no American borders completely. She doesn’t want anybody deported, even people, illegals, convicted of murder and rape. A day after Oct. 7, she showed up at a pro-Hamas rally in Times Square. That would be the equivalent of losing 40,000 Americans in a day, if you extrapolate out the population. Brags about using the American flag to wipe her hands. Now, is that your party? Is that who you are? Would you vote for her?
DE BLASIO: Sean, the question is why did the people of that district vote for her? And I’ll tell you why.
HANNITY: No, no, no, no, no. That’s your question. I asked you a different question. My question is simple. Hang on! Would you vote for her?
DE BLASIO: She is the Democratic nominee. I would vote for her, yes, but let me tell you what’s going on here.
HANNITY: Wow.
DE BLASIO: Sean, you can do your lists, but what’s really happening is she spoke out against what America has been doing in the Middle East, and a lot of Americans, you know, Sean, a clear majority of Americans do not think we should be in a war with Iran, including a lot of people supporting Donald Trump. A clear majority of Americans think that what the [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in] Netanyahu government has done in Israel to the Palestinian people is wrong. Wait, wait, wait. Let me finish!
HANNITY: We’re not talking about Israel. No, no, no. We’re not talking about Israel.
DE BLASIO: Sean, Sean. Just give me a second.
HANNITY: No. We’re talking about she wants to abolish the police, she wants no borders, she wants illegals that commit murder and rape to not go to prison, and I’m asking you, you were the mayor of New York City, I’m asking you if you would vote for this lady and you’re telling me yes? You’d vote for this lunatic?
DE BLASIO: Yeah, and I’ll tell you why. No, I don’t think she’s a lunatic. I disagree with her. Sean, I can’t believe you’ve never voted for someone you’ve had some disagreements with.
HANNITY: Not like this.
DE BLASIO: Sean, for you and your many, many viewers, this is what’s going on in the Democratic Party. A lot of people who vote Democrat are saying, “We want to see Democrats take on Trump, not cower before him.” They think ICE is totally broken. I believe in secure borders. I don’t believe in ICE. They think what we’re doing in the Middle East is wrong. They think that nothing’s being done to address the cost of living. You go down this list. When these candidates talk about “Medicare For All,” there’s a whole lot of Americans who would like to have better health insurance, who can’t make ends meet. So, I think you should realize why these people are voting for these progressive candidates. Because they represent change.
HANNITY: Mr. Mayor, you would never abolish the police. You would secure the border. She wants to seize public property. She doesn’t want private ownership of property.
DE BLASIO: A single member of Congress doesn’t make those decisions, and you know it.
